The Challenge Louisville Property Owners Face
Our city presents specific obstacles. Historic homes in Old Louisville require careful prep work on century-old wood siding. Brick exteriors in the Highlands develop moisture issues during our humid summers. Homes near Beargrass Creek deal with elevated dampness that shortens paint life. Generic advice from out-of-town contractors rarely addresses these realities.

Why Local Knowledge Matters
Consider the difference between a contractor who understands Louisville and one who doesn't. Professionals in our network know that south-facing exteriors in Germantown need UV-resistant coatings. They recognize when homes near Cherokee Park require mildew-resistant primers. They've worked through our unpredictable spring weather and know how to schedule around it.
